HP OfficeJet Pro 7740 Wide Format All-in-One Printer

Two issues.

 

1) My new printer (7740) is recognizing the black ink, but not the cyan, magenta, or yellow.  They don't seem to "click" in all the way and it keeps telling me to check them for leaks.  These are the inks that came with the printer, so are genuine HP inks.

 

2) I just checked online, and it says the warranty expired a month before I purchased it.  Not sure what this means?

Perform the following tasks in the order given. Use the printer after each task to see if the issue is resolved.

Clean the printhead

  • Use an automated tool to clean the printhead to restore print quality.
  • Load plain white paper into the tray.
  • On the printer control panel, swipe down on the touchscreen to open the Dashboard.
  • Touch the Setup icon .
  • Touch Printer Maintenance, and then touch Clean Printhead.

Check for issues with the ink cartridges

  • Very low ink levels and using non-HP cartridges can cause print quality issues.
  • Replace any non-HP or refilled cartridges with genuine HP cartridges. HP supplies are available from the HP Store and local retailers.
  • HP cannot guarantee the quality or reliability of non-HP or refilled cartridges. Go to HP Anti Counterfeiting and Fraud Program for more information.
  • On the printer control panel, swipe down on the touchscreen to open the Dashboard, and then touch the Ink Level Indicator icon .
  • Check the ink levels and replace any low or empty cartridges.

Ink levels

  • Rough handling of cartridges during transport or installation can cause print quality problems. Wait a few hours for the automatic servicing routine to complete, and then try to print again.
  • If you have a defective HP cartridge, it might be under warranty. Go to About Original HP Cartridges for page yield and HP Limited Warranty information.
